In Battle of the Bulge:
CLEAR terrain (with no vegetation at all) provides +10% hit chance. OPEN terrain (dotted with a couple of trees) provides no bonus.
Shenandoah Studio had it right, but Slitherine mistakingly treats OPEN terrain as CLEAR terrain.
The only bonus-providing CLEAR terrains are Namur, Hingeon, Verviers and Huy.
The bridge strategically placed on Namur is broken. It mysterious functions only as a one-way bridge. Sloppy SLOPPY mistake.
